First Stop: The Magnificent Fortress, Amber Fort
A magnificent sight, Amber Fort rises from the rough hills just outside Jaipur. This fort, which combines Mughal and Hindu architecture, is replete with historical narratives, elaborate carvings, and mirror work.
Explore Sheesh Mahal (Mirror Palace), take in the expansive vistas from the ramparts, and listen to your knowledgeable guide recount the bravery of the Rajput monarchs.

Ancient Astronomy in Action at Jantar Mantar
Jantar Mantar, one of the oldest astronomical observatories in the world and a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is located just next to the City Palace. Built in the 18th century, these enormous telescopes were used to track celestial bodies and calculate time with surprisingly high accuracy.
The Famous Palace of Winds, Hawa Mahal
A visit to Hawa Mahal, the famous five-story mansion designed to allow royal women to view city activity covertly, is a must-do while in Jaipur. With its 953 tiny windows, the pink sandstone façade is perhaps one of India's most photographed landmarks.
